Weird vacuum readings

Hey guys I need some help. Today on my drive home I noticed when I let off the gas I was getting 30 inHg of vacuum. My idle is around 18. I got the car back from putting in my new tranny recently and replaced some of the rusty clamps on the ic piping. The only other thing I did to my car today was change my oil. I accidentally put in 5 quarts but drained some out. That shouldnt have affected my vacuum. I have HKS 264 cams as well. Any help is needed as I just wanted to make sure it is alright and im not stressing.

18 inHg at idle is normal for your setup. When you let up on the throttle, in gear, the motor is still spinning at speed and trying to draw air through the closed throttle. So you will see a higher vacuum than if you were idling in neutral. Your readings are okay.
